Cost Overview

Most families pay around $33,000 annually after aid, not the $57,000 sticker price. Low-income students get the biggest break, paying about $27,600 per year, while wealthy families still pay around $36,000. Over four years, expect to spend roughly $132,000 total.

Kettering's co-op program helps offset costs since students alternate between classes and paid internships. The typical graduate leaves with $27,000 in debt, translating to $286 monthly payments. With median starting salaries at $80,700, that debt payment represents just 4% of gross income. Within five years, graduates earn a median $102,000.

Only 46% of students take federal loans, suggesting many families can afford the net price without borrowing heavily. The 87% loan repayment rate shows graduates can handle their debt load. Engineering students from moderate-income families get the best financial deal here, combining substantial aid with strong earning potential.
